What Barium chloride is

Barium chloride is white orthorhombic crystals and is odorless. Its molecular formula is BaCl2 and its molecular weight is 208.23 g/mol. It boils at 1560 °C, melts at 961 °C.

Under the GHS it carries the signal word Danger.

02 · GHS classification

Hazards and label elements

Harmonised classification under CLP Annex VI. This is the legally binding classification in the EU; other jurisdictions may differ.

Signal wordDanger
Hazard statements assigned to Barium chloride
CodeHazard statement
H301 Toxic if swallowed.
H332 Harmful if inhaled.

Precautionary statements: P260, P270, P271, P301, P304, P310, P312, P330

04 · Handling and storage

Storing and handling Barium chloride

Storage conditions

Separated from food and feedstuffs.

Source: Hazardous Substances Data Bank (HSDB)

Incompatible materials

Bromine trifluoride rapidly attacks barium chloride.

Source: Hazardous Substances Data Bank (HSDB)

Reactivity

BARIUM CHLORIDE may react violently with BrF3 and 2-Furan percarboxylic acid in its anhydrous form. (NTP, 1992)

Source: CAMEO Chemicals
